The 2025 Formula One season marked the Ferrari debut of Lewis Hamilton and to everyone’s surprise the Englishman produced the worst season of his racing career. He failed win a single race, a podium and even pole. The veteran finished P6 in the championship with just 156 points to his name and the noise around his drop in performance was significant.
Some in the racing community is expecting Ferrari to make a decision soon on whether to replace Lewis Hamilton and ex-Haas F1 team boss Guenther Steiner already knows the right guy to replace him. On his recent appearance on Red Flags podcast, the Austrian talked about Oliver Bearman and how the youngster has grown as racer, now making less mistakes and taking calculated risks.
[At the start of 2025 he was] fast, but making mistakes. But in the second half of the season, he got rid of them, just like a switch. Because in the first half of the season, I thought he was taking too much risk with the car he had, and therefore had a few offs. It wasn’t good. He got a lot of penalty points, and he still kept collecting them in the second half of the season.
Guenther Steiner said via Red Flags podcast (Via RN365).
The Englishman has already proven his worth with his string fights and overtaking prowess. Steiner knows Lewis Hamilton will leave Ferrari if he doesn’t get the car he needs to succeed in the 2026 season, the obvious candidate to replace him is Bearman. The young racer is part of the Maranello system, has previously raced for them substituting Carlos Sainz and is ready for the big move.
But it’s just like he didn’t make mistakes anymore, even in the races. He was fighting hard, and we all know he can overtake. I think, for him, the door should be open at Ferrari for ’27 because if Lewis hasn’t got the success he needs, I don’t think he continues. And then [Bearman] is the obvious candidate there for Ferrari — a guy who is well prepared for F1 and is performing. And also, he’s good with everything else around him.
Guenther Steiner added.
The stats from the 2025 season proves the points made by Guenther Steiner. Bearman finished the season with 41 points on sub-par Hass car, scoring the best Finish of P4 which is same as Hamilton. Him outscoring veteran teammate Estaban Ocon, 41 to 32, shows he is ready to be the future the sport.
Lewis Hamilton pledges his loyalty to Ferrari
Despite the challenging 2025 season, Lewis Hamilton isn’t ready to give up and is determined to prove himself. In a recent interview, the seven times champion asserted that he wants to conquer the mountains with Ferraro and is ready to keep going until he achieves that goal.

There are just many mountains that I have yet to conquer. Everything that I challenge myself to work towards, I truly believe I can get there. I haven’t climbed that mountain yet. If you don’t have any ‘yets’, then you’ve got nothing to will you forward. Even if you’ve been working at something for years and still don’t feel like you’re there, it’s okay. You keep going, and you will get there.
Lewis Hamilton said.
The champion driver will have a mark or break season in 2026, that is going to redefine his Formula One legacy. If he can’t get back to winning form and compete for the championship, he might need to look into completing his racing bucket list in other championships as the father time is catching up to him faster than ever.
